Перейти к содержанию

Установка и настройка SQL Server 2016

ℹ️ В данном разделе приведена инструкция для установки SQL Server 2016. Для более старших версий процесс установки принципиально не отличается. Установка и настройка SQL Server 2019 описана здесь

ℹ️ Данная инструкция предназначена для SQL Server 2016. Для актуальных версий (2019 и новее) используйте инструкцию tech_req_1f_prepare_sql.md.

1. Установите SQL Server 2016 или выше. В зависимости от размеров базы данных и необходимых функций можно использовать различные редакции.

Выберите пункт Новая установка

2. Некоторые информационные окна с проверками компонентов системы в данном описании пропущены, описаны лишь существенные моменты установки необходимых компонентов. Обязательно необходимы компоненты управления и службы полнотекстового поиска:

3. Выберите экземпляр по умолчанию, т.к. это будет единственный экземпляр сервера:

4. Настройте запуск от имени системы:

5. Важно проверить, чтобы была установлена сортировка Cyrillic_General_CI_AS для Database Engine, т.к. она задается только при установке и для ее изменения в дальнейшем потребуется переустанавливать сервер.

6. Установите авторизацию в смешанный режим. Добавьте текущего пользователя в администраторы SQL сервера. На данном шаге можно также заполнить вкладку TempDB, указав количество баз, чтобы позже не настраивать это вручную.

7. В поле Корневой каталог данных укажите путь к папке, где будут размещаться файлы баз данных (рекомендуется использовать отдельный от ОС физический диск).

8. Дождитесь завершения установки.

9. Откройте SQL Management Studio и в свойствах сервера измените значение параметра Максимальная степень параллелизма на 4. Этот параметр регулирует работу с процессорными ядрами, которые сервер может привлекать на обработку запроса. В параметре Оптимизировать для нерегламентированной рабочей нагрузки установите True.

ℹ️ Значение зависит от нагрузки. Для высоконагруженных систем рекомендуется значение 1 (см. документ по оптимизации производительности БД).

По умолчанию удаленный доступ к серверу может быть закрыт, поэтому нужно разрешить подключение.
10. Запустите утилиту Диспетчер конфигурации SQL Server (Пуск — Все программы — Microsoft SQL Server 2016 — Средства настройки — Диспетчер конфигурации SQL Server).
В разделе Сетевая конфигурация SQL Server — Протоколы для ... для строки TCP/IP вызовите контекстное меню (правой кнопкой мыши) и выберите пункт Свойства.
На вкладке Протокол установите параметр Включено в значение Да, а на закладке IP-адреса в ветке IPAll установите параметр TCP-порт в значение 1433. Затем нажмите ОК.

Аналогичным способом настоятельно рекомендуем отключить все остальные протоколы, кроме TCP/IP.

11. В разделе Службы SQL Server для строки SQL Server (…) вызовите контекстное меню (правой кнопкой мыши) и выберите пункт Перезапустить (этот пункт можно пропустить, если Вы перезагрузите компьютер после завершения остальных настроек):

12. Если вы устанавливаете SQL Server на НЕ русскоязычную ОС Windows, после окончания установки на сервере откройте панель управления (Control Panel), перейдите в раздел Time & Language, затем в раздел Language и нажмите на ссылку Administrative language settings. Нажмите кнопку Change system locale, для Language for non-Unicode programs выберите язык Russian и снова перезагрузите компьютер:

На этом подготовка SQL Server к установке "Первой Формы" завершена.